Shares of Micro Cap Biotech Jump as New Law Opens Florida to Company’s Stem Cell Treatments

Stem cell therapies are gradually becoming a viable medical option for a range of health conditions. Today, a micro-cap biotech company made a significant announcement in this area, sending its shares soaring on the news.

Shares of Hemostemix Inc. (TSX-Venture: HEM) (OTCQB: HMTXF) are on the move higher as the clinical-stage biotechnology company specializing in autologous stem cell therapies for cardiovascular diseases, announced this morning that Florida Senate Bill 1768 became law on July 1, 2025. This new legislation allows patients and their physicians in Florida to access non-FDA-approved autologous stem cell treatments with informed consent, clearing the way for Hemostemix to legally offer its ACP-01 (VesCell) therapy in the state. The company plans to begin commercial treatments by Q4 2025.

Hemostemix projects $22.5 million in sales for 2026 and aims to exceed this target through strategies like selling forward its therapy convertible debentures, offering payment plans, and providing financial assistance to disadvantaged patients. Under the new law, licensed Florida physicians may administer ACP-01 (VesCell) for ischemia-related pain in conditions such as Peripheral Arterial Disease, Chronic Limb Threatening Ischemia, angina, congestive heart failure, dilated cardiomyopathy, and peripheral neuropathy linked to total body ischemia.

"With 498 patients treated to-date and published results demonstrating safety, improvement in cardiac function, mobility, and pain reduction, ACP-01 is positioned to be the #1 therapy for patients with no other treatment options," stated CCO of Hemostemix, Croom Lawrence.

Shares of HEM were lasted trading at $0.15, up 15.38% while U.S. listed shares (HMTXF) rallied 18.99% to $0.1084 in mid-afternoon trading.
